Joe Jackson Thinks Michael's Death Was A Homicide
No one was more surprised to hear that Michael Jackson was being rushed to the hospital than his own father, Joe Jackson.
"I just couldn't believe that was happening to Michael," the elder Jackson told ABC in an exclusive interview. "I do believe it was foul play. I do believe that."
The family personally requested a second autopsy for Michael and the father says they are still waiting on police toxicology reports to determine whether the King of Pop's death should be ruled as a homicide or an accidental overdose.
Yet, even in the midst of immense grief, the patriarch of the Jackson clan is still very attentive to the future of this legendary family. He firmly believes that he and his wife Katherine should have custody over Jackson's three children. Furthermore, he is already considering how to take advantage of his grandchildren's talent.
"I don't know -- I keep watching Paris. She
wants to do something," he said. "And as far as I can see, well, they say Blanket, he can really dance."
